DHL to construct integrated distribution centre in Vietnam

DHL Group has announced that it would build DHL integrated distribution centre in ICD Song Than, Binh Duong province yesterday.

The new integrated distribution centre will be constructed with construction area of 15,000 square metres, under DHL’s standards.

The project has total investment capital of $1.5 million. This is one part of the general plan for expanding the infrastructure network of DHL’s distribution chain in Vietnam. The new centre will help push up providing solutions and services in the current network for current enterprises to meet the international standards.
